1. Processed Meats

Processed meats, including bacon, sausages, and deli meats, are known to be harmful to health when eaten in excess. These foods often consist of preservatives such as nitrates and nitrites, which are used to improve their shelf life and preserve their color. However, when eaten over long periods, these chemicals can break down into potentially carcinogenic compounds that increase the risk of developing stomach and colorectal cancers. 2. Pickled Foods

Pickled foods, including vegetables and fruits, are staples in many households because of their tangy flavor and long shelf life. However, the high salt content in pickled items can show a danger to health when eaten in large quantities. Excessive salt intake has been connected to an increased risk of stomach can.cer.
